Author: slaws
Date: Fri Jun 10 08:15:32 2011
New Revision: 1134228
URL: http://svn.apache.org/viewvc?rev=1134228&view=rev
Log:
Flush the XML stream writer
Modified:
tuscany/sca-java-2.x/trunk/modules/node-impl/src/main/java/org/apache/tuscany/sca/node/impl/NodeImpl.java
Modified:
tuscany/sca-java-2.x/trunk/modules/node-impl/src/main/java/org/apache/tuscany/sca/node/impl/NodeImpl.java
URL:
http://svn.apache.org/viewvc/tuscany/sca-java-2.x/trunk/modules/node-impl/src/main/java/org/apache/tuscany/sca/node/impl/NodeImpl.java?rev=1134228&r1=1134227&r2=1134228&view=diff
==============================================================================
---
tuscany/sca-java-2.x/trunk/modules/node-impl/src/main/java/org/apache/tuscany/sca/node/impl/NodeImpl.java
(original)
+++
tuscany/sca-java-2.x/trunk/modules/node-impl/src/main/java/org/apache/tuscany/sca/node/impl/NodeImpl.java
Fri Jun 10 08:15:32 2011
@@ -26,6 +26,7 @@ import java.util.logging.Level;
import java.util.logging.Logger;
import javax.xml.stream.XMLOutputFactory;
+import javax.xml.stream.XMLStreamWriter;
import org.apache.tuscany.sca.assembly.Component;
import org.apache.tuscany.sca.assembly.ComponentService;
@@ -359,11 +360,14 @@ public class NodeImpl implements Node, N
.getFactory(XMLOutputFactory.class);
try {
- compositeProcessor.write(composite,
outputFactory.createXMLStreamWriter(bos), new
ProcessorContext(nodeFactory.registry));
+ XMLStreamWriter xmlStreamWriter =
outputFactory.createXMLStreamWriter(bos);
+ compositeProcessor.write(composite, xmlStreamWriter, new
ProcessorContext(nodeFactory.registry));
+ xmlStreamWriter.flush();
} catch(Exception ex) {
return ex.toString();
}
+
String result = bos.toString();
// write out and nested composites